Every year on March 10th, Third Day, a leather memorial service is held at Abuto Kannon Temple in Numakuma-cho, Fukuyama City.
This year, all of our staff went to offer prayers to express their gratitude.
A Rinzai sect temple located on Cape Afuto.
The Kannon Hall, built by Mori Terumoto between 1570 and 1573, is designated as an Important Cultural Property of Japan.

The scraps of leather used throughout the year will be rolled up into a ball, and once the school bag has been remade it will be carved into the shape of a cherry blossom and a sutra will be read aloud.
As I listen to the head priest's sutra, a feeling of gratitude for the life of the leather that we use every day naturally wells up in my mind.

School bag memorial service
At Third, we also hold memorial services for school bags that have been remade.
School bag remake - a school bag that has been used for six years is transformed into a new item that can be used in everyday life.
We started in 2011 and have remade over 2,000 school bags.
After remaking the backpack, we will either return it or donate it, according to the customer's wishes.
